Backup is a life saviour.Ensure its there!
Let’s have an overview about it π
Implementing effective backup strategies for your Linux server is crucial to ensure data integrity and availability. One of the most reliable methods is to utilize automated backup tools that can schedule regular backups without manual intervention.Tools such as rsync, Bacula, or Duplicity can be configured to create incremental backups, which only capture changes made since the last backup, thereby saving both time and storage space. Additionally, it is advisable to store backups in multiple locations, such as local storage, external drives, or cloud services, to mitigate the risk of data loss due to hardware failure or other unforeseen events.
Another essential practice is to regularly test your backup restoration process. Having a backup is only half the battle; ensuring that you can successfully restore your data when needed is equally important.Conducting periodic drills to restore data from backups will help identify any potential issues in the backup process and ensure that your team is familiar with the restoration procedures.This proactive approach not only enhances your disaster recovery plan but also builds confidence in your backup system’s reliability.
Furthermore, it is vital to maintain proper documentation of your backup procedures and configurations.This documentation should include details about the backup schedule, the types of data being backed up, and the locations of the backups.Keeping this information up to date will facilitate easier management and troubleshooting of your backup system.Additionally, consider implementing encryption for sensitive data during the backup process to enhance security and protect against unauthorized access.By following these best practices, you can significantly improve the resilience of your Linux server against data loss.